Medhex-M Forte Gel is used to treat mouth ulcers. The detailed uses of Medhex-M Forte Gel are as follows:
Medhex-M Forte Gel is a combination medication containing Metronidazole (an antibiotic), Lidocaine (local anaesthetic), and Chlorhexidine (an antiseptic). Medhex-M Forte Gel is primarily used to treat mouth ulcers. Lidocaine helps treat mouth ulcers by forming a protective layer on the ulcer, blocking the transmission of pain signals to the brain, and decreasing the pain sensation. Chlorhexidine is an antiseptic and disinfectant that effectively cleans out the ulcer's surface to prevent infection. Metronidazole is bactericidal in nature and kills the bacteria by damaging its DNA and preventing these bacteria's growth from spreading, hence relieving the symptoms. As a result, good oral hygiene is maintained, and it is easier to go out and perform daily activities.

Medhex-M Forte Gel is used to treat mouth ulcers and gum inflammation.
Medhex-M Forte Gel contains  Metronidazole (an antibiotic), Lidocaine (local anaesthetic), and Chlorhexidine (an antiseptic). These constituents prevent bacterial growth and block the transmission of pain signals to the brain, and decrease the pain sensation. Thus, it treats mouth ulcers.
Medhex-M Forte Gel may stain teeth if taken for a prolonged time. So, it is advised to take it for a short duration as it is a short-term medication.
A bitter taste may be one of the side effects of Medhex-M Forte Gel. It is temporary and usually gets resolved after you stop using the medicine.
If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is time for the next sc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and follow your usual dosage.
Melt ice chips over the ulcers and rinsing your mouth with water mixed with salt or baking soda may help to lessen pain. Avoid spicy, acidic, and abrasive foods. Your doctor may prescribe anti-ulcer gels that may treat and relieve pain.
Apply a small amount of gel or cream to the affected area with a clean finger or cotton swab, 2-3 times a day, or as directed by your physician. After applying, avoid rinsing your mouth, eating, or drinking for 30 minutes. Remember, this product is for topical use in the mouth only and should not be swallowed.
Medhex-M Forte Gel is not recommended for children under 12 years old. For children above 12, use it only if a child specialist has prescribed it. Always consult a doctor before giving this medication to children to ensure safe and appropriate use.
No, Do not swallow the Medhex-M Forte Gel. It is for topical use in the mouth only.
Lidocaine helps treat mouth ulcers by forming a protective layer on the ulcer, blocking the transmission of pain signals to the brain, and decreasing the sensation of pain. Chlorhexidine is an antiseptic and disinfectant that effectively cleans out the ulcer surface to prevent infection, and metronidazole, being bactericidal, kills the bacteria by damaging its DNA and preventing these bacteria's growth spread, hence relieving the symptoms. As a result, good oral hygiene (any practice or activity that you do to keep things healthy and clean) is maintained.
Yes, Medhex-M Forte Gel causes a metallic taste. It is mild and temporary and usually gets resolved after you stop the usage of medication. If the side effects are persistent and bothersome, please consult your doctor.
Medhex-M Forte Gel should be stored in a cool and dry place away from sunlight. Dispose of expired or unused medication at a designated drug take-back location or pharmacy. Please consult your doctor if you have any concerns regarding it.
The common side effects of Medhex-M Forte Gel may include metallic taste, bitter taste, burning, transient redness, irritation, dryness, and staining of teeth. Most of these side effects resolve over time. If these side effects are persistent and bothersome, please consult your doctor.
